多多色-多人伦交性欧美在线观看-多人伦精品一区二区三区视频-多色视频-免费黄色视屏网站-免费黄色在线

中國最全IT社區平臺 聯系我們 | 收藏本站
阿里云優惠2

aspnet教程

  • ASP.NET 教程
  • ASP.NET 簡介
  • ASP.NET Razor

    ASP.NET MVC

    ASP.NET 編程指南

    ASP.NET Web Pages Email

    閱讀 (2307)

    ASP.NET Web Pages - WebMail 幫助器


    WebMail 幫助器 - 眾多有用的 ASP.NET Web 幫助器之一。


    WebMail 幫助器

    WebMail 幫助器讓發送郵件變得更簡單,它按照 SMTP(Simple Mail Transfer Protocol 簡單郵件傳輸協議)從 Web 應用程序發送郵件。


    前提:電子郵件支持

    為了演示如何使用電子郵件,我們將創建一個輸入頁面,讓用戶提交一個頁面到另一個頁面,并發送一封關于支持問題的郵件。


    第一:編輯您的 AppStart 頁面

    如果在本教程中您已經創建了 Demo 應用程序,那么您已經有一個名為 _AppStart.cshtml 的頁面,內容如下:

    _AppStart.cshtml

    @{
    WebSecurity.InitializeDatabaseConnection("Users", "UserProfile", "UserId", "Email", true);
    }

    要啟動 WebMail 幫助器,向您的 AppStart 頁面中增加如下所示的 WebMail 屬性:

    _AppStart.cshtml

    @{
    WebSecurity.InitializeDatabaseConnection("Users", "UserProfile", "UserId", "Email", true);
    WebMail.SmtpServer = "smtp.example.com";
    WebMail.SmtpPort = 25;
    WebMail.EnableSsl = false;
    WebMail.UserName = "support@example.com";
    WebMail.Password = "password-goes-here";
    WebMail.From = "john@example.com";

    }

    屬性解釋:

    SmtpServer: 用于發送電子郵件的 SMTP 服務器的名稱。

    SmtpPort: 服務器用來發送 SMTP 事務(電子郵件)的端口。

    EnableSsl: 如果服務器使用 SSL(Secure Socket Layer 安全套接層)加密,則值為 true。

    UserName: 用于發送電子郵件的 SMTP 電子郵件賬戶的名稱。

    Password: SMTP 電子郵件賬戶的密碼。

    From: 在發件地址欄顯示的電子郵件(通常與 UserName 相同)。


    第二:創建一個電子郵件輸入頁面

    接著創建一個輸入頁面,并將它命名為 Email_Input:

    Email_Input.cshtml

    <!DOCTYPE html>
    <html>
    <body>
    <h1>Request for Assistance</h1>

    <form method="post" action="EmailSend.cshtml">
    <label>Username:</label>
    <input type="text name="customerEmail" />
    <label>Details about the problem:</label>
    <textarea name="customerRequest" cols="45" rows="4"></textarea>
    <p><input type="submit" value="Submit" /></p>
    </form>

    </body>
    </html>

    輸入頁面的目的是手機信息,然后提交數據到可以將信息作為電子郵件發送的一個新的頁面。


    第三:創建一個電子郵件發送頁面

    接著創建一個用來發送電子郵件的頁面,并將它命名為 Email_Send:

    Email_Send.cshtml

    @{ // Read input
    var customerEmail = Request["customerEmail"];
    var customerRequest = Request["customerRequest"];
    try
    {
    // Send email
    WebMail.Send(to:"someone@example.com", subject: "Help request from - " + customerEmail, body: customerRequest );
    }
    catch (Exception ex )
    {
    <text>@ex</text>
    }
    }

    想了解更多關于 ASP.NET Web Pages 應用程序發送電子郵件的信息,請查閱:WebMail 對象參考手冊。


    關閉
    程序員人生
    主站蜘蛛池模板: 91人人爱| 免费观看在线永久免费xx视频 | 欧美精品18videosex性欧美 | 222aaa免费 | 亚洲爽视频 | 男人边吃奶边做好爽男女视频 | 久久综合精品国产一区二区三区无 | 国内自拍小视频 | 国产成人久久精品区一区二区 | 日韩免费高清一级毛片在线 | 黑人疯狂做人爱视频 | 日韩男人的天堂 | 亚洲无砖砖区免费 | 欧美毛片网站 | 亚洲欧美日韩专区一 | 久久不卡一区二区三区 | 久久精品国产400部免费看 | 日韩国产欧美精品综合二区 | 国产午夜亚洲精品久久999 | 高清国产性色视频在线 | 国产一区二区三区成人久久片 | 香焦伊人 | 老女人在线视频 | 欧美日韩精品一区三区 | 武则天免费一级淫片 | 久久精品一区二区 | 亚洲国产一区二区三区综合片 | 99久久精品国产综合男同 | 久久精品区 | 高清视频在线观看 | 亚洲黄色网址在线观看 | 美女上床视频 | 国产人成精品综合欧美成人 | v亚洲| 亚洲精品第一第二区 | 亚洲免费片 | 亚洲最新黄色网址 | 日本一区二区在线不卡 | 特级aa一级欧美毛片 | 国产成+人+综合+亚洲不卡 | 美女网站免费观看视频 |